Crescent Adjustable Construction Wrenches feature a round, tapered tang for easy alignment of bolt holes. A large knurl allows for easy adjustment and a tight-fitting hex jaw design reduces slippage and tightly grips the fastener for solid, secure operation. The corrosion-resistant black oxide finish helps prevent rust. This is the ideal wrench for any iron or steel worker's tool box.

What is this type of wrench used for?
The Crescent Construction Wrench, commonly referred to as a spud wrench, features a tapered spike at the end of the handle to easily help align bolt holes while on the job.
What material is this wrench made from?
This wrench is made from heat-treated forged alloy steel for ultimate toughness and durability with a black oxide finish to resist rust and corrosion.
